Filling out the online application should be one of the last things you do, when you’re completely ready to submit everything to New York... because the date you submit the online application and pay for the visa is your official application date and all your documents must be ready on that date (I.e. her most recent financial documentation (latest bank statement) must be dated no more than 28 days before the date she submits the online application).
She can keep saving the online application as she goes, but should not submit it until she’s ready to go.
Just to check that she has selected the correct visa type on the online application?
She needs to apply under:
Settlement -> Settlement -> Wife

Her visa vignette will be made valid for 30 days from the Intended Travel Date she puts on the application form (or actually it’s usually made valid starting 7 days before that date), and the date she puts can be up to 6 months in the future (if that date passes before the visa has been processed, it will be made valid from around the time the decision is made instead).
